CEFOTAXIME

(Claforan)

Dosages

Infants and Children: 35-70 mg/kg/dose IM/IV Q8H

Severe Infections: 50 mg/kg/dose IM/IV Q6H .

Meningitis: 75 mg/kg/dose IM/IV Q6H (300 mg/kg/24 hr IV div. Q4-Q6H).

Maximum: 2000 mg IV Q4H

Adults: Usual dose 1-2 g IM/IV Q6-8H. Maximum: 2 g IV Q4H

Mechanism of Action

Third-generation cephalosporin antibiotic

Forms Supplied

Injection: 1 g, 2 g

Comments

Dosage adjustment is required in severe renal impairment.

Third generation cephalosporin with similar spectrum of activity to ceftriaxone.

Cefotaxime is preferred over ceftriaxone in the neonatal population (see ceftriaxone dosing monograph).
